A brake consisting essentially of the following: a. A brake anchor bracket, also called a carrier assembly, which is the basic unit of the brake. It is designed to be attached to the torque flange of the axle and is also the part upon which the other components of the brake are assembled. b. A floating hydraulically actuated annular piston, or an equivalent mechanical device, used for applying braking pressure. c. Metallic disks keyed to rotate with the wheel alternated with nonrotating disks keyed to the anchor bracket. See also brake, segmented rotor.
